What is special about Dexos oil?
Dexos oil is engine oil that meets a special set of requirements. Dexos oil is also specially formulated for proper lubrication, sludge reduction, friction level moderation and controlling temperatures – the latter being especially important in vehicles with turbochargers or superchargers, as they create more heat.
What happens if you don’t use Dexos oil?
When GM says Dexos is “recommended” for 2011 and newer GM vehicles, it means that if you don’t use Dexos, or a synthetic oil that meets Dexos specifications, your warranty could be voided if your engine suffers oil-related damage.

Why is Dexos oil different?
Dexos® oils are formulated exclusively with synthetics or synthetic blends. Better antioxidant technology that keeps oil from oxidizing. Dexos® oils generally have a drain interval of up to 15,000 miles. Lower viscosity that holds up to engine combustion and heat better and longer than other oils on the market.

What is the difference between Dexos 1 and Dexos 2 oil?
Dexos 1 works for gasoline engine and Dexos 2 is for diesel engine and in some cases for gasoline engines as well. Thus recently this oil is being used only for diesel engines. On the other hand the Dexos 1 oil has been evolved with two different categories and the Dexos1 gen 2 is the most updated one.

Why is high mileage oil not Dexos?
Pennzoil Platinum High Mileage in the appropriate grade is API SN only.
It’s not ILSAC GF-5, and therefore incapable of achieving dexos1.

How good is Dexos oil?
According to GM, the Dexos oil specification will decrease harmful piston deposits by up to 28 percent and improve fuel efficiency by up to 0.
3 percent compared to the older ILSAC GF-4 specifications.
